The following link will take you to a PBworks page that gives tips for educators using wikis in their classroom. It also provides a directory of educational wikis posted by teachers. The Wiki provides pages like Wiki Etiquette, Protecting your students online, and How to introduce Wikis to your students.
I have begun a wiki for my grade 1 French Immersion classroom and gave each student a page. I would like to have them post their work, things they build, and artwork. My only conundrum is how to I prevent this space from becoming a comparison of student performance by parents and students? I can change the settings to allow invited members only but I also need to ensure that viewers are celebrating the work of their child and not making camparaisons among the many levels of ability in my classroom.
We will see how this adventure in technology unfolds.
